Introduction

2 Introduction

Indonesia is the largest economy in Southeast Asia. It is the fourth-most populous country and has

the 17th largest economy in the world. Post-independence, it has seen tremendous economic

development, partly as a result of government changes to its regulatory framework, which have

increased investment from both the foreign and domestic private sector. Despite this, Indonesia

struggles with poverty, unemployment, corruption, poor infrastructure, a complex regulatory

environment and unequal resource distribution among regions.

With an estimated Gross Domestic Product (GDP) (at current prices) of $XX billion in 2013,

Indonesia registered growth of XX% in the same year (CIA, 2014). The industry sector was

estimated to account for XX% of Indonesia’s GDP in 2013, followed by the service sector (XX%)

and the agriculture sector (XX%). Indonesia has substantial natural resources, including crude oil,

natural gas, tin, copper and gold. It is a major importer of chemicals, fuels, food items, machinery,

equipment, and crude oil. Indonesia exports gas, coal, electrical appliances, rubber, textiles and

plywood. Its major trading partners are China, Japan, Singapore and the US. Since 1998,

Indonesia’s oil production has declined, owing to its largest oil fields’ reached maturity and its

inability to develop new comparable resources. Despite being a net importer of crude oil, since

2004 it has been the world’s sixth-largest net exporter of natural gas and second-largest net

exporter of coal.

The Ministry of Energy and Mineral Resources (Kementerian Energi dan Sumber daya Mineral,

MEMR) is the chief regulator of the electricity sector and is responsible for the legislation,

implementation, co-ordination, enforcement and compliance of the electricity sector. Perusahaan

Listrik Negara (PLN), a state-owned utility, is the dominant company in the power sector. It owns

XX% of Indonesia's power-generating capacity through its subsidiaries and maintains a monopoly

over Transmission and Distribution (T&D) activities. The remaining XX% is owned by the private

sector through Independent Power Producers (IPP). This contribution of IPPs is likely to increase,

as new private power projects are expected to come online in the next few years. The electrification

ratio in Indonesia is currently XX% but is expected to increase owing to increasing private

investments in the electricity infrastructure.

9 Appendix

9.1 Market Definitions

9.1.1 Power

Power refers to the rate of production, transfer or energy use, usually related to electricity. It is

measured in Watts (W) and often expressed in kilowatts (kW) or Megawatts (MW). It is also known

as real power or active power.

9.1.2 Installed Capacity

Installed capacity refers to the generator’s nameplate capacity as stated by the manufacturer, or

the maximum rated output of a generator under given conditions. It is given in Megawatts (MW) on

a nameplate affixed to the generator.

9.1.3 Electricity Generation

Electricity generation refers to the process of generating electricity from other forms of energy. It

also refers to the amount of electricity produced, expressed in Gigawatt hours (GWh).

9.1.4 Electricity Consumption

Electricity consumption is the sum of electricity generated, plus imports, minus exports and

transmission and distribution losses. It is measured in Gigawatt hours (GWh).

9.1.5 Coal-Fired Power Plant

A coal-fired power plant produced electricity from the combustion of coal.

9.1.6 Hydropower Plant

A hydropower plant is a plant in which the turbine generators are driven by falling or flowing water.

9.1.7 Nuclear Power

Nuclear power is the energy released from the fission of nuclear fuel in a reactor.

9.1.8 Renewable Energy Resources

Renewable energy resources are those that provide energy that is naturally replenished but limited

in the amount of energy available per unit of time. Biomass, geothermal, solar, small hydro and

wind are examples of renewable resources.
